North Olmsted 10:30 AM - 8:00 PM 10:30 AM - 8:00 PM 10:30 AM - 8:00 PM 10:30 AM - 8:00 PM 10:30 AM - 8:00 PM 10:30 AM - 8:00 PM 10:30 AM - 7:00 PMphone(440) 734-4440(440) 734-4440356 Great Northern Mall North Olmsted, OH 44070 USView DetailsORDER NOWORDER CATERING